| unit MouseInputIntf;
 | |
| 
 | |
| {$mode objfpc}{$H+}
 | |
| 
 | |
| interface
 | |
| 
 | |
| uses
 | |
|   Classes, SysUtils, Controls, Forms;
 | |
|   
 | |
| type
 | |
|   { TMouseInput }
 | |
| 
 | |
|   TMouseInput = class
 | |
|   protected
 | |
|     procedure DoDown(Button: TMouseButton); dynamic; abstract;
 | |
|     procedure DoMove(ScreenX, ScreenY: Integer); dynamic; abstract;
 | |
|     procedure DoUp(Button: TMouseButton); dynamic; abstract;
 | |
|   public
 | |
|     procedure Down(Button: TMouseButton; Shift: TShiftState);
 | |
|     procedure Down(Button: TMouseButton; Shift: TShiftState; Control: TControl; X, Y: Integer);
 | |
|     procedure Down(Button: TMouseButton;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
|     
 | |
|     procedure Move(Shift: TShiftState; Control: TControl; X, Y: Integer; Duration: Integer = 0);
 | |
|     procedure MoveBy(Shift: TShiftState; DX, DY: Integer; Duration: Integer = 0);
 | |
|     procedure Move(Shift: TShiftState; ScreenX, ScreenY: Integer; Duration: Integer);
 | |
|     procedure Move(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
| 
 | |
| 
 | |
|     procedure Up(Button: TMouseButton; Shift: TShiftState);
 | |
|     procedure Up(Button: TMouseButton; Shift: TShiftState; Control: TControl; X, Y: Integer);
 | |
|     procedure Up(Button: TMouseButton;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
|     
 | |
|     procedure Click(Button: TMouseButton; Shift: TShiftState);
 | |
|     procedure Click(Button: TMouseButton; Shift: TShiftState; Control: TControl; X, Y: Integer);
 | |
|     procedure Click(Button: TMouseButton;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
|     
 | |
|     procedure DblClick(Button: TMouseButton; Shift: TShiftState);
 | |
|     procedure DblClick(Button: TMouseButton; Shift: TShiftState; Control: TControl; X, Y: Integer);
 | |
|     procedure DblClick(Button: TMouseButton;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
|   end;
 | |
| 
 | |
| implementation
 | |
| 
 | |
| uses
 | |
|   Math, MouseAndKeyInput, LCLIntf;
 | |
| 
 | |
| { TMouseInput }
 | |
| 
 | |
| procedure TMouseInput.Down(Button: TMouseButton; Shift: TShiftState);
 | |
| begin
 | |
|   KeyInput.Apply(Shift);
 | |
|   try
 | |
|     DoDown(Button);
 | |
|   finally
 | |
|     KeyInput.Unapply(Shift);
 | |
|   end;
 | |
|   Application.ProcessMessages;
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Down(Button: TMouseButton; Shift: TShiftState;
 | |
|   Control: TControl; X, Y: Integer);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Control.ClientToScreen(Point(X, Y));
 | |
|   Down(Button, Shift, P.X, P.Y);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Down(Button: TMouseButton; Shift: TShiftState;
 | |
|   ScreenX, ScreenY: Integer);
 | |
| begin
 | |
|   KeyInput.Apply(Shift);
 | |
|   try
 | |
|     DoMove(ScreenX, ScreenY);
 | |
|     DoDown(Button);
 | |
|   finally
 | |
|     KeyInput.Unapply(Shift);
 | |
|   end;
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Move(Shift: TShiftState; Control: TControl; X, Y: Integer; Duration: Integer = 0);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Control.ClientToScreen(Point(X, Y));
 | |
|   Move(Shift, P.X, P.Y, Duration);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.MoveBy(Shift: TShiftState; DX, DY: Integer; Duration: Integer = 0);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Mouse.CursorPos;
 | |
|   Move(Shift, P.X + DX, P.Y + DY, Duration);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Move(Shift: TShiftState; ScreenX, ScreenY: Integer; Duration: Integer);
 | |
| const
 | |
|   Interval = 20; //ms
 | |
| var
 | |
|   TimeStep: Integer;
 | |
|   X, Y: Integer;
 | |
|   Start: TPoint;
 | |
|   S: LongWord;
 | |
| begin
 | |
|   Start := Mouse.CursorPos;
 | |
|   
 | |
|   while Duration > 0 do
 | |
|   begin
 | |
|     TimeStep := Min(Interval, Duration);
 | |
| 
 | |
|     S := GetTickCount;
 | |
|     while GetTickCount - S < TimeStep do Application.ProcessMessages;
 | |
|     
 | |
|     X := Start.X + ((ScreenX - Start.X) * TimeStep) div Duration;
 | |
|     Y := Start.Y + ((ScreenY - Start.Y) * TimeStep) div Duration;
 | |
|     Move(Shift, X, Y);
 | |
| 
 | |
|     Duration := Duration - TimeStep;
 | |
|     Start := Point(X, Y);
 | |
|   end;
 | |
|   
 | |
|   Move(Shift, ScreenX, ScreenY);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Move(Shift: TShiftState; ScreenX, ScreenY: Integer);
 | |
| begin
 | |
|   KeyInput.Apply(Shift);
 | |
|   try
 | |
|     DoMove(ScreenX, ScreenY);
 | |
|   finally
 | |
|     KeyInput.Unapply(Shift);
 | |
|   end;
 | |
|   Application.ProcessMessages;
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Up(Button: TMouseButton; Shift: TShiftState);
 | |
| begin
 | |
|   KeyInput.Apply(Shift);
 | |
|   try
 | |
|     DoUp(Button);
 | |
|   finally
 | |
|     KeyInput.Unapply(Shift);
 | |
|   end;
 | |
|   Application.ProcessMessages;
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Up(Button: TMouseButton; Shift: TShiftState;
 | |
|   Control: TControl; X, Y: Integer);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Control.ClientToScreen(Point(X, Y));
 | |
|   Up(Button, Shift, P.X, P.Y);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Up(Button: TMouseButton; Shift: TShiftState;
 | |
|   ScreenX, ScreenY: Integer);
 | |
| begin
 | |
|   Move(Shift, ScreenX, ScreenY);
 | |
|   Up(Button, Shift);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Click(Button: TMouseButton; Shift: TShiftState);
 | |
| begin
 | |
|   Down(Button, Shift);
 | |
|   Up(Button, Shift);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Click(Button: TMouseButton; Shift: TShiftState;
 | |
|   Control: TControl; X, Y: Integer);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Control.ClientToScreen(Point(X, Y));
 | |
|   Click(Button, Shift, P.X, P.Y);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.Click(Button: TMouseButton; Shift: TShiftState;
 | |
|   ScreenX, ScreenY: Integer);
 | |
| begin
 | |
|   Move(Shift, ScreenX, ScreenY);
 | |
|   Click(Button, Shift);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.DblClick(Button: TMouseButton; Shift: TShiftState);
 | |
| begin
 | |
|   Click(Button, Shift);
 | |
|   Click(Button, Shift);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.DblClick(Button: TMouseButton; Shift: TShiftState;
 | |
|   Control: TControl; X, Y: Integer);
 | |
| var
 | |
|   P: TPoint;
 | |
| begin
 | |
|   P := Control.ClientToScreen(Point(X, Y));
 | |
|   DblClick(Button, Shift, P.X, P.Y);
 | |
| end;
 | |
| 
 | |
| procedure TMouseInput.DblClick(Button: TMouseButton; Shift: TShiftState;
 | |
|   ScreenX, ScreenY: Integer);
 | |
| begin
 | |
|   Move(Shift, ScreenX, ScreenY);
 | |
|   DblClick(Button, Shift);
 | |
| end;
 | |
| 
 | |
| 
 | |
| 
 | |
| end.
